## Greetings and Farewell "Hello" in L'ewa is said using `xoi`. It can also be used as a reply to hello similar to «ça va» in French. It is possible to have an entire conversation with just `xoi`: ``` xoi xoi xoi ``` The other implications of `xoi` are "how are you?" "I am good, you?", "I am good", etc. If more detail is needed beyond this, then it can be supplied instead of replying with `xoi`. "Goodbye" is said using `xei`. Like `xoi` it can be used as a reply to another goodbye and can form a mini-conversation: ``` xei xei xei ```
